## TumbleVault Environments

Quick refresher before the next release: TumbleVault handles the locker access flow for FreshFold's laundry pickup service. A resident scans their code, we validate against the reservation ledger, and the locker pops open. Staging talks to the mock ledger in Brindlewick; prod hits the real one, so be careful with smoke tests. Each environment keeps its own door-timeout and retry settings, and they drift more than we'd like. The current production configuration values are as follows.

service settings:
PRAIX_LOG_LEVEL=error
PRAIX_METRICS_HOST=metrics.praix.qorvelcorp.corp
PRAIX_POOL_SIZE=16

Handover: StageView seat-map renderer

Renderer is stable on current build. Known issues: balcony tier mislabels rows when a venue config omits aisle markers; workaround is the fallback grid. SVG export works; PDF export still behind a flag, don't enable for release. Perf budget is 200ms for a 1,200-seat layout — we're at 170ms. Tests green except one flaky zoom snapshot, safe to ignore. Config schema docs are in the repo wiki. For release sign-off and any open questions, the responsible engineer is listed below.

named custodian: Brivan Eliath Quenox Frador

**Q: How do I run the LiftLab dispatch simulator locally?**

A: You don't, at first. LiftLab needs the Hoistway config bundle, which contractors get after onboarding review. Once granted, run the sim in replay mode only; live-dispatch mode touches shared state and will break other sessions. Scenario files live in the sim repo under /scenarios. Don't edit the baseline traffic profiles. Full setup steps, known quirks, and the contractor checklist are on the internal page below.

dashboard of tahop-fahof = https://harbor.tolvaqnet.example/secrets/merge_requests/board/issue/merge_requests/pipeline/secrets/ecb30ed86a55c001a77f6cb9